Lakewood requires building permits for scaffolding over 10 feet per Ohio Building Code adopted via Codified Ordinances Chapter 1321. OSHA 1926.451 standards apply to commercial jobs.
Lakewood Building Department enforces the Ohio Building Code (OBC) for commercial scaffolds and the Residential Code of Ohio (RCO) for 1-3 family homes. Scaffolds over 10 feet or adjacent to the public right-of-way require a permit application with contractor liability insurance on file. Sidewalk obstruction in Lakewoods dense Detroit Avenue and Madison Avenue corridors requires a separate Street Obstruction Permit from the Engineering Division. Guardrails at 42 inches, toeboards, and base plates on mud sills are inspected during framing phase.
Stop-work orders issued for unpermitted scaffolds. Fines start at 150 dollars per day until corrected; repeat offenders cited under Chapter 1305 as first-degree misdemeanors.
